Well, you would need to gut the existing electronics (for the fluoro). It would be really nice if the high/low could be made to work - but with standard cheapo made in china led arrays they are just a bunch of leds with a series resistor. I guess you could wire an additional series resistor from the switch - but you are burning power in the resistor if you don't have some fancier electronics like a pwm dimmer etc. IMHO it is hardly worth having LEDs if you can't dim them to conserve power and get only as much light as you need.

Other than being a 'project', it's a bunch of work for something that is big/heavy. Without a diffuser the light will be irritating if you ever looked in its direction.

LEDs are current driven devices. You need a current regulated driver to properly drive them. A buck driver steps voltage down. A boost driver steps voltage up. A buck/boost can do both.

I design/make LED drivers for a living. Unless you really want to get into the whole DIY scene, just buy a LED lantern - lots on the market.

Got scared off. I found the perfect led panals, but did research and found that when they say 12v, they are serious. If you think that a standard battery is 1.63V charged, times 8 batteries, you get 13.04 V. Well, many of these boards will burn up if you shoot 13v to them.

There is some fancy thing that will stop this, but costs more than the project was worth to me..... Looking at some cree chips in a smaller light now.
